With an .htaccess file, you shall define how the server that handles the requests to your web sites have to act in different cases. This is a text file with directives that are executed when someone tries to open your website and what happens next will depend on the content of the file. For example, you may block a certain IP address from opening the Internet site, therefore the server will decline the visitor’s request, or you can forward your domain to some other URL, so the server will direct the visitor to the new web address. You can also use tailor-made error pages or secure any part of your Internet site with a password, if you place an .htaccess file in the correct folder. Many well-known script-driven apps, such as WordPress, Joomla and Drupal, use an .htaccess file to operate efficiently.
